Advance Notice; No Liens. Tenant shall keep the Building and Project free of all liens with respect to all work and materials performed and provided in connection with such sign, and Tenant shall give Landlord at least ten (10) days prior written notice of the intended commencement of work in connection with the Exterior Building Sign.
